refactor: use local variables in shell functions in build scripts (#771)
We translate function arguments (e.g: `$1`, `$2`, etc) to readable names using shell variables in the top of every shell function in the build scripts. Since we were not declaring these variables as `local`, two functions using the same "argument name" would override each other. For example: ```sh function foo() { variable=$1 # Do something with $variable } function bar() { variable=$1 # Do something with $variable } foo "Hello World" echo $variable > Hello World bar "Changed variable" echo $variable > Changed variable ``` Signed-off-by: Juan Cruz Viotti <jviotti@openmailbox.org>
